- August 10 2009 Lake County Illinois 8:00pm. Wind W 6mph. 70 degrees. Partly Cloudy, Chance of Thunder Storm 40% Barometer 29.93 Steady, Waning Gibbous 77% of the Moon is Illuminated. Big 19 Point Non Typical Buck in the Soybean Field. With the end of summer rapidly approaching, the big bucks are getting harder & harder to find. The velvet is drying and getting close to being striped & the mature bucks are waiting until later & later in the evening to venture out in the open to feed.
